Understanding the dth drilling machine price requires a comprehensive look at what these powerful tools offer to industries ranging from mining and construction to geothermal exploration and water well drilling. DTH, which stands for Down-The-Hole, represents a drilling technology where the hammer mechanism is located directly at the drill bit rather than at the surface. This fundamental design difference significantly impacts both performance and pricing structures. The dth drilling machine price typically varies based on several critical factors including drilling depth capacity, hole diameter range, operational power requirements, and manufacturer specifications. Modern DTH drilling machines are engineered to penetrate hard rock formations with exceptional efficiency, delivering precise boreholes in challenging geological conditions. These machines incorporate pneumatic or hydraulic power systems that drive the hammer mechanism, creating a percussive action that fractures rock while simultaneously rotating the drill string. The dth drilling machine price reflects the sophisticated engineering involved in these systems, encompassing components such as air compressors, drill rigs, hammer tools, and drill bits. When evaluating the dth drilling machine price, customers should consider the machine's operational specifications including maximum drilling depth ranging from 50 to 500 meters, hole diameter capabilities from 85mm to 254mm, and air pressure requirements typically between 15 to 35 bar. The technological features embedded in these machines include advanced rod rotation systems, precise feed control mechanisms, dust collection capabilities, and automated drilling parameter monitoring. Applications span across multiple sectors: mining operations utilize these machines for exploration and blast hole drilling, construction projects depend on them for foundation work and anchoring systems, water well drilling companies rely on them for creating efficient water extraction points, and geothermal projects employ them for heat exchange system installation. The dth drilling machine price encompasses not just the primary equipment but also auxiliary components such as drill pipes, couplings, bits, and maintenance tools that ensure sustained operational performance across diverse working environments.

Cost-Effectiveness Through Superior Penetration Rates

Cost-Effectiveness Through Superior Penetration Rates

When analyzing the dth drilling machine price from a performance perspective, the exceptional penetration rates these machines achieve stand out as a defining characteristic that directly translates to financial advantages for operators across all industry segments. The fundamental mechanics of DTH drilling technology position the hammer mechanism immediately behind the drill bit, ensuring that virtually all generated impact energy transfers directly into the rock face without dissipation through long drill strings. This engineering approach results in penetration rates that frequently exceed conventional drilling methods by factors of two to four times, depending on geological conditions and equipment specifications. For contractors and mining operations, these accelerated drilling speeds mean completing boreholes in substantially less time, which cascades into multiple cost benefits throughout your operation. Labor expenses decrease proportionally as crews accomplish more work within standard shift durations, and equipment rental periods shorten when you own or lease the machinery on time-based contracts. The dth drilling machine price becomes increasingly justified as you calculate the per-meter drilling costs across hundreds or thousands of boreholes throughout a machine's operational lifetime. Additionally, faster penetration rates reduce wear on consumable components because the drill bit spends less total time in contact with abrasive rock formations, extending the service life of bits, hammers, and drill pipes that represent ongoing operational expenses. Project timelines compress significantly when drilling operations accelerate, allowing construction firms to reach subsequent project phases sooner and mining operations to access ore bodies more quickly, generating revenue faster and improving cash flow dynamics. The enhanced penetration capability proves particularly valuable in hard rock environments where traditional rotary drilling struggles, often requiring supplemental techniques or specialized bits that increase costs substantially. By maintaining consistent high-performance drilling across varied geological conditions, DTH machines eliminate the productivity valleys that plague other drilling technologies when encountering unexpected hard formations. The dth drilling machine price reflects equipment designed for sustained high-output operation, incorporating durable components and robust construction that withstand the intense forces generated during rapid penetration without frequent breakdowns or performance degradation. This reliability ensures that the superior penetration rates remain consistent throughout extended operational periods rather than diminishing as equipment ages or components wear.
Versatile Application Range Maximizing Equipment Utilization

Versatile Application Range Maximizing Equipment Utilization

The dth drilling machine price provides access to remarkably versatile equipment capable of addressing diverse drilling requirements across multiple industries and applications, maximizing your investment return through broad utilization possibilities that eliminate the need for maintaining specialized machines for different project types. This adaptability stems from the fundamental DTH drilling principle that remains effective across an extensive range of hole diameters, drilling depths, and geological conditions, allowing a single machine configuration to handle varied assignments that would traditionally require different equipment categories. Water well drilling operations benefit from DTH technology's ability to create clean, straight boreholes through consolidated formations at depths reaching several hundred meters, producing wells with optimal flow characteristics and minimal deviation that could compromise casing installation. Mining exploration and production drilling similarly leverage these machines for creating blast holes with precise spacing and depth control, ensuring efficient explosive utilization and desired fragmentation results that optimize subsequent ore extraction processes. The dth drilling machine price encompasses equipment equally suited for geothermal applications where accurate vertical or angled drilling creates efficient heat exchange systems, environmental sampling projects requiring uncontaminated core samples from specific depths, and construction anchoring systems demanding precise placement of foundation supports in challenging bedrock conditions. This versatility extends beyond application types to encompass operational environments, as DTH drilling machines function effectively in confined underground settings, open-pit operations, remote wilderness locations, and urban construction sites with varying access constraints and regulatory requirements. Operators appreciate the flexibility to accept diverse contract opportunities without investing in additional specialized equipment, improving business agility and competitive positioning in markets where project variety is common. The adjustable parameters available on modern DTH drilling machines allow operators to optimize performance for specific conditions by modifying air pressure, rotation speed, feed pressure, and hammer selection to match geological characteristics and hole specifications. This customization capability means the dth drilling machine price represents investment in equipment that adapts to your needs rather than forcing you to adapt projects to equipment limitations. Auxiliary component compatibility further enhances versatility, as standardized connection interfaces allow operators to interchange bits, hammers, and stabilizers from various manufacturers, providing access to specialized tools for unique applications without equipment platform changes. Training investments also benefit from this versatility, as operators developing proficiency on DTH equipment gain transferable skills applicable across multiple project types rather than learning narrow skill sets tied to specialized machinery. The resulting equipment utilization rates typically far exceed those of more specialized drilling technologies, distributing the dth drilling machine price across more productive operating hours and generating superior return on investment metrics.
Reduced Operational Complexity and Maintenance Requirements

Reduced Operational Complexity and Maintenance Requirements

Evaluating the dth drilling machine price must include consideration of the significantly simplified operational demands and maintenance requirements that characterize DTH drilling technology compared to alternative methods, delivering long-term cost advantages that substantially improve total ownership economics throughout the equipment's service life. The mechanical simplicity of the DTH hammer design, featuring relatively few moving parts operating in a straightforward percussive cycle, contrasts sharply with the complex hydraulic and mechanical systems required by competing drilling technologies. This fundamental simplicity translates directly into reduced maintenance frequency, as fewer components experience wear and those that do are easily accessible for inspection and replacement without extensive disassembly procedures. Operators find that routine maintenance procedures for DTH equipment typically involve straightforward tasks such as lubrication, visual inspections, and periodic replacement of wear components according to predictable schedules based on operating hours or meters drilled. The dth drilling machine price includes equipment designed for field maintenance by operators with standard mechanical skills rather than requiring specialized technicians or factory service interventions for routine upkeep. Downtime associated with maintenance activities remains minimal because component replacement procedures are streamlined and parts availability is generally excellent due to standardization across the industry and multiple competing suppliers for consumable items. The robust construction standards applied to DTH drilling machines ensure that structural components and major assemblies withstand the intense operational stresses inherent to percussive drilling without developing fatigue failures or requiring frequent rebuilds. This durability extends the intervals between major overhauls significantly compared to equipment categories involving more complex mechanical movements or higher component counts with multiple potential failure points. Diagnostic procedures for identifying performance issues remain straightforward, as the limited number of variables affecting DTH drilling operation simplifies troubleshooting and allows operators to quickly pinpoint problems through systematic evaluation of air pressure, rotation function, and feed system performance. The dth drilling machine price reflects equipment engineered for sustained operation in harsh environments including dusty conditions, temperature extremes, and remote locations where service support may be limited and equipment reliability becomes paramount to project success. Consumable component costs remain reasonable due to competitive markets for bits, hammers, and drill pipes, with multiple quality tiers available to match budget constraints and performance requirements for specific applications. The predictable wear patterns of these consumables enable accurate operational cost forecasting and inventory management, eliminating unexpected expense spikes that disrupt project budgets. Operator training requirements focus primarily on safe equipment operation and recognizing normal performance parameters rather than complex technical knowledge of intricate mechanical systems, reducing the learning curve and allowing new personnel to contribute productively after relatively brief orientation periods. This operational simplicity extends to daily startup and shutdown procedures, equipment transport and positioning, and parameter adjustments during drilling, collectively reducing the cognitive load on operators and minimizing errors that could damage equipment or compromise hole quality.
